The videofluorographic swallowing study (VFSS), also known as a modified barium swallowing examination (MBS) is often considered the instrument of choice by the majority of practicing swallowing clinicians because it permits the visualization of bolus flow in relation to structural movement throughout the upper aerodigestive tract in real-time. The Modified Barium Swallow Impairment Profile, or MBSImP, is a standardized approach to instruction, assessment, and reporting of physiologic swallowing impairment based on observations obtained from the MBS study. The videofluoroscopic swallowing study, also known as the Modified Barium Swallow (MBS), is a videofluoroscopic, radiographic test that differs from the traditional barium swallow procedures (e.g., pharyngoesophagram and upper gastrointestinal series) in both procedure and purpose.
